Factors Influencing Costs
- Site Size: Larger sites typically require more work and equipment, increasing costs.
- Soil Type: Rocky or clay-heavy soils may need specialized equipment or additional labor.
- Slope and Elevation: Steeper slopes require more extensive grading efforts.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-access sites may incur additional transportation and labor costs.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and regulatory requirements can add to the overall cost.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can delay work and increase labor costs.
- Equipment Used: The type and amount of equipment needed can significantly affect pricing.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Maryville, TN) |
---|---|
Site Survey | $300 - $500 |
Basic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 per acre |
Erosion Control | $500 - $1,500 |
Soil Testing | $200 - $600 |
Drainage Installation | $1,500 - $5,000 |
Final Grading | $1,000 - $2,500 |
